Intermediate treatment of industrial waste with a focus on recycling

Technology / Service Summary

Provision of 90% recycling rate in intermediate treatment of industrial waste and production of recycled heavy oil and raw cement fuel from waste

Purpose

Intermediate treatment business for industrial waste in all fields

Feature

・Drastically cut carbon dioxide emissions by industrial waste intermediate treatment that mainly recycle without incineration
・The company manufactures and sells recycled fuel and coal substitute fuel for cement calcination to reduce fossil fuel use and carbon dioxide emissions at its customers.

Effect

Incinerating industrial waste as it produces a lot of CO2, but Daiseki can treat it with less CO2 than incineration. For waste oil and sludge, etc., the SCOPE 3 category (5) (waste) is zero for customers who outsource their recycling to Daiseki.

Accomplishments

The Daiseki Group has achieved a recycling rate of 87.7%. The total amount of materials we received for recycling was about 2,061,000 tons in FY2023. We contributed to reduce 559,000 tons of CO2 emissions compared to simple incineration through low emissions recycling process of industiral waste. In addition we contributed to reduce the fossil fuel consumption ; substituting 39,000kl of heavy oil A and 130,000 tons of coal with recycled fuel.
